ROWING 3,000 miles across the Atlantic is a ridiculous thing to do, even if you are a two-time gold medal Olympian rower like James Cracknell.

The idea that Ben Fogle former Blue Peter labrador puppy turned wildlife presenter should even entertain the idea seems even more bizarre.

Sadly, the documentary offers little more than a straight run-though of events, and seems to leave several big rocks unturned.

It gives us rumours of hallucinations, nervous breakdowns and blind rage, but we get to see precious little of them. It will no doubt be a hit with Ben's legion of housewife fans, but it's hard to imagine why anyone else would want to own it on DVD.
